Accident sends 15 to YRMC
Fifteen people were injured Tuesday morning when a bus carrying field workers and a station wagon collided just outside of Somerton.
The accident happened near the area of County 13th Street and Avenue G just after 6:30 Tuesday morning, said Robby Rodriguez, spokesman for the Somerton/Cocopah Fire Department.
It was unclear what caused the accident, but Rodriguez said when his department arrived, the bus carrying more than 20 field workers was laying on its roof and rescue crews had to use the Jaws of Life, a hydraulic-powered metal prying tool, to get two passengers out of the station wagon.
Thirteen field workers and the two people in the station wagon were transported to Yuma Regional Medical Center for treatment.
Rodriguez said the people in the station wagon were experiencing difficulty breathing and the 13 people in the bus had injuries that included neck and back pains.
Names of those injured were not available.
The accident is being investigated by the Yuma County Sheriff's Office, which was unavailable for comment Tuesday.
